CPCB Multi-Year History (2016–2024)
Summary
Overview
In 2024, Jaipur averaged an AQI of 136 while Vijayawada averaged 64 — a 72-point (113%) gap, with Jaipur the more polluted and Vijayawada the cleaner of the two. On 913 days when both cities reported, Vijayawada was cleaner on 874 of them; the average daily gap was 96 AQI points.
Seasonality & days
Jaipur peaks in November, while Vijayawada peaks in February. Jaipur logged 0.1% Severe days and 26.799999999999997% Good-or-Satisfactory days; Vijayawada was 0.2% Severe and 86.8% Good-or-Satisfactory. Longest clean-air streaks: Jaipur 57 days, Vijayawada 72 days.
Year-over-year progress
Jaipur has improved by 53 AQI points (28%) from 2017 to 2024; Vijayawada has improved by 21 AQI points (24.7%) over the same window. The worst recorded day for Jaipur reached AQI 452 at Shastri Nagar (RSPCB) on 2018-02-06; Vijayawada hit AQI 500 at Kanuru (APPCB) on 2023-04-04.
Station-level disparity
Jaipur spans 6 CPCB stations with a 48-point spread (min 112, max 160); Vijayawada spans 5 stations with a 9-point spread (min 65, max 74).
